LOUISVILLE, KY. (THECOUNT) — Cynthia S. Inabnitt has been identified as the pedestrian fatally struck by a vehicle on Saturday in Louisville.
“Cindy” Inabnitt, 41, died in the 4600 block of Dixie Highway around 8 p.m. Saturday after colliding with a vehicle, according to Jefferson County Deputy coroner.
Smith was transported to an area hospital where she was later pronounced dead of multiple blunt force trauma injuries.
The driver remained on the scene and cooperated with officials.
Police said no charges were being filed against the driver and no one was cited at the scene.
